Understanding Low Fidelity Manikins
Low fidelity manikins are simplified models that allow learners to practice basic clinical and procedural skills. Unlike high fidelity simulation tools, which provide an immersive and realistic experience, low fidelity manikins focus on specific tasks and foundational skills. These manikins are ideal for training beginners, as they help build confidence and competence before advancing to more complex scenarios.
Benefits of Low Fidelity Manikins
Cost-Effective Training
Low fidelity manikins are significantly more affordable than their high-fidelity counterparts. This makes them an excellent choice for institutions with limited budgets. They enable widespread access to training resources without compromising the quality of education.
Skill Development
These manikins focus on developing psychomotor skills and procedural techniques. For instance, learners can practice CPR, wound dressing, intravenous insertion, and patient positioning repeatedly until they achieve proficiency. The ability to isolate specific tasks ensures that students master each skill individually.
Accessibility
Low fidelity manikins are portable and easy to set up, making them suitable for various educational settings. From classrooms to basic clinical labs, these tools can be integrated seamlessly into the curriculum.
Safe Learning Environment
Mistakes are an integral part of the learning process. Low fidelity manikins provide a safe space where learners can make errors without risking patient safety. This encourages experimentation and fosters a deeper understanding of medical procedures.
Applications of Low Fidelity Manikins
Nursing Education
Low fidelity manikins play a crucial role in nursing education by allowing students to practice fundamental skills. They help learners gain confidence in procedures such as administering injections, catheterization, and monitoring vital signs. By linking these exercises to real-world applications, students are better prepared for clinical practice.
Basic Life Support (BLS) Training
In BLS courses, low fidelity manikins are used extensively to teach CPR and airway management techniques. Their straightforward design enables learners to focus on the critical steps required to save lives.
Task-Specific Training
These manikins are ideal for training in specific tasks, such as wound care, suturing, and bandaging. Their simplicity ensures that learners can concentrate on perfecting individual techniques.
Simulation-Based Training
While often used independently, low fidelity manikins can also complement advanced simulation techniques. For example, combining these tools with scenario-based learning enhances the overall training experience by bridging theoretical knowledge with practical skills.
Comparing Low and High Fidelity Manikins
While low fidelity manikins are excellent for foundational training, high fidelity simulation tools provide a more immersive experience. High fidelity simulation offers realistic scenarios, complete with physiological responses and interactive feedback. However, the cost and complexity of high fidelity tools can be a barrier for some institutions. Integrating both types of simulators into a training program ensures a comprehensive approach to skill development.
